这个问题看起来像是围绕这个问题的所有先前问题的重复,特别是这个问题PHPInstagramAPI-HowtogetMIN_TAG_IDandMAX_TAG_ID.但是随着新的API更改,以前的答案不再有效。目标我想为特定标签请求媒体。文档关于gettingtaggedmedia的Instagram文档指定您需要具有public_content范围并且有4个可用参数;ACCESS_TOKEN、COUNT、MIN_TAG_ID和MAX_TAG_ID。我的API请求https://api.instagram.com/v1/tags/cats/media/recent?access_token
关闭。这个问题不符合StackOverflowguidelines.它目前不接受答案。要求我们推荐或查找工具、库或最喜欢的场外资源的问题对于StackOverflow来说是偏离主题的,因为它们往往会吸引自以为是的答案和垃圾邮件。相反,describetheproblem以及迄今为止为解决该问题所做的工作。关闭8年前。ImprovethisquestionOpenIDConnect仍然有点新,我目前正在寻找开源软件来运行我自己的OpenIDConnect提供程序(OP服务器)。应该尽可能简单(Java或PHP),以便能够快速搭建测试环境。但它也应该允许我添加自定义插件,例如让OP连接到额
PHP数组元素引用的背景假设您使用嵌套的PHP数组创建一个复杂的数据结构,如下所示:$a1=array('b'=>array('foo'=>1),'c'=>array('bar'=>1));想象一下,数组嵌套得更深,元素更多,名称更长、更有意义。如果需要经常访问$a1的子结构,以进行读写,可能会想创建一个这样的“别名”:$b=&$a1['b'];然而,由于“赋值”实际上改变了$a1,这会导致大量困惑。我认为许多没有经验的PHP开发人员(像我一样)会假设$b是在赋值后对$a1['b']的引用。真正发生的是,$b和$a1['b']都变成了对元素array('foo'=>1)的引用,产生了意
我的意思是...让我们只发出一个AJAX请求并将结果插入到div#result中..在后端,脚本使用ob_flush()发送header但不会终止请求,直到它终止(使用exit或ob_flush_end)仅当请求终止(exit或ob_flush_end)时,内容才会加载到#result中,或者每次脚本发送header时都会加载内容ob_flush?更新:我将使用jQueryload()发出请求&PHP来回答它 最佳答案 是的,内容会被返回,但是XHR对象的readyState不会被设置为4,所以如果你依赖它来更新你的div(大多数J
关闭。这个问题需要更多focused.它目前不接受答案。想改进这个问题吗?更新问题,使其只关注一个问题editingthispost.关闭8年前。ImprovethisquestionPHP5.3已于前一段时间发布,开发人员试图将向后兼容性中断的数量保持在较低水平。在使用PHP5.3测试/迁移代码时,您发现了哪些问题?
你能在回调中使用$this来获取phpunit中模拟类的protected属性吗?或者有其他方法可以实现吗?$mock=$this->getMock('A',array('foo'));$mock->expects($this->any())->method('foo')->will($this->returnCallback(function(){return$this->bar;}));如果您考虑注入(inject)模拟对象,这可能非常有用。有时类对其他类具有硬编码依赖性,但它使用理论上可以模拟并创建模拟对象而不是硬编码对象的方法来创建它。请看另一个例子。classA{protec
有没有一种方法可以在PHP/jQuery中设置自动完成功能,可以快速运行数据库中的数千行?我有一个工作板,用户可以在其中输入他/她的大学-我想提供自动完成功能。问题是,美国有4,500所大学,这似乎是一个糟糕的解决方案。有没有一种既能加快查询速度又能仅在可用选项少于10个时才返回结果的好方法?先谢谢你,沃克 最佳答案 我同意Anax。您可能想看看像新的jQueryUIAutocompletefield这样的简单解决方案。.使用delay和minLength选项,您可以让脚本在用户输入三个字符之前不查询服务器,这会减少结果的数量。附言
我习惯了在写函数时检查参数类型的习惯。有理由支持或反对吗?例如,将字符串验证保留在此代码中还是将其删除是好的做法,为什么?functionrmstr($string,$remove){if(is_string($string)&&is_string($remove)){returnstr_replace($remove,'',$string);}return'';}rmstr('sometext','text');有时您可能期望不同的参数类型并为它们运行不同的代码,在这种情况下验证是必不可少的,但我的问题是我们是否应该显式检查类型并避免错误。 最佳答案
在我的codeigniter项目中,我尝试使用InstagramAPI进行登录。This是我正在使用的库。但是进入登录页面时,显示错误{"code":403,"error_type":"OAuthForbiddenException","error_message":"Youarenotasandboxuserofthisclient"}示例网址是https://www.instagram.com/oauth/authorize/?client_id=[clientID]&redirect_uri=[yoururl]&response_type=code为什么会这样?任何帮助都将不胜感
我正在尝试在codeigniter中制作一个简单的登录系统。当我点击我的按钮登录时,出现错误:Theactionyouhaverequestedisnotallowed.当我打开我的控制台时,我看到了这个:POSThttp://localhost/PHP/PROJECT/CodeIgniter/403(Forbidden)这是我的观点:LOGIN!Username:PasswordLOGIN!这是我的模型:db->select("username","password");$this->db->from(user);$this->db->where('username',$userna